Subject: [PATCH net-next 1/2] cxgb4: Fix namespace collision issue.

+/**
+ * t4_init_tp_params - initialize adap->params.tp
+ * @adap: the adapter
+ *
+ * Initialize various fields of the adapter's TP Parameters structure.
+ */
+int t4_init_tp_params(struct adapter *adap)
+{
+ int chan;
+ u32 v;
+
+ v = t4_read_reg(adap, TP_TIMER_RESOLUTION);
+ adap->params.tp.tre = TIMERRESOLUTION_GET(v);
+ adap->params.tp.dack_re = DELAYEDACKRESOLUTION_GET(v);
+
+ /* MODQ_REQ_MAP defaults to setting queues 0-3 to chan 0-3 */
+ for (chan = 0; chan < NCHAN; chan++)
+ adap->params.tp.tx_modq[chan] = chan;
+
+ /* Cache the adapter's Compressed Filter Mode and global Incress
+ * Configuration.
+ */
+ t4_read_indirect(adap, TP_PIO_ADDR, TP_PIO_DATA,
+ &adap->params.tp.vlan_pri_map, 1,
+ TP_VLAN_PRI_MAP);
+ t4_read_indirect(adap, TP_PIO_ADDR, TP_PIO_DATA,
+ &adap->params.tp.ingress_config, 1,
+ TP_INGRESS_CONFIG);
+
+ /* Now that we have TP_VLAN_PRI_MAP cached, we can calculate the field
+ * shift positions of several elements of the Compressed Filter Tuple
+ * for this adapter which we need frequently ...
+ */
+ adap->params.tp.vlan_shift = t4_filter_field_shift(adap, F_VLAN);
+ adap->params.tp.vnic_shift = t4_filter_field_shift(adap, F_VNIC_ID);
+ adap->params.tp.port_shift = t4_filter_field_shift(adap, F_PORT);
+ adap->params.tp.protocol_shift = t4_filter_field_shift(adap,
+ F_PROTOCOL);
+
+ /* If TP_INGRESS_CONFIG.VNID == 0, then TP_VLAN_PRI_MAP.VNIC_ID
+ * represents the presense of an Outer VLAN instead of a VNIC ID.
+ */
+ if ((adap->params.tp.ingress_config & F_VNIC) == 0)
+ adap->params.tp.vnic_shift = -1;
+
+ return 0;
+}
